I used to customize all of my keys for all kinds of power usage, but
at the end of the day I found that learning the GNU readline library
and sticking to bash and emacs is a much better approach. Practically
all the applications I now use regularly, ( XEmacs, Bash, gdb, ncftp
etc.. ) all use the the same key bindings.
I avoid aliases also, for the same reason.
my .bashrc is now tiny. Wish I could say the same for my .emacs.
